Samsung working on slimmer RWB camera sensors

29 May

Photos from a Samsung presentation have emerged online, providing some insight about the company’s upcoming image sensors for mobile devices. It appears Samsung is working on chips that use a RWB (red, white, blue) color filter instead of the conventional RGB pattern. This allegedly improves color fidelity and light sensitivity, allowing for smaller pixels. In turn, this could mean smaller camera modules in future smartphones. Read more
